Q: What is the difference between reptiles and amphibians?
A: Reptiles and amphibians are two distinct groups of creatures with some key differences that set them apart. Reptiles typically have dry, scaly skin and lay eggs with hard shells. They also tend to live in dry, terrestrial environments and usually can’t survive in water. On the other hand, amphibians have moist skin adapted for living partially in water and on land. Generally, they lay soft-shelled eggs that must remain moist in order to develop. So while both reptiles and amphibians are fascinating creatures, they do have some key differences in their physical characteristics.
Q: Are snakes reptiles or amphibians?
A: Snakes are reptiles! Snakes typically have long, slender bodies covered in dry scales and most lay leathery-shelled eggs that can withstand the dry terrestrial environment. They are able to survive in a variety of habitats, but typically inhabit warm temperate or tropical climates.
Q: What types of adaptations do reptiles and amphibians have?
A: Reptiles and amphibians have many interesting adaptations that help them survive in different environments. Reptiles tend to have specialized body features that help them move through the environment like strong claws, long legs, sticky tongues, and thick scales. Amphibians usually have adapted their skin to absorb oxygen from both the air and water, as well as features like flattened feet and tails to help them swim. Both reptiles and amphibians tend to have the ability to camouflage, to regulate their body temperature, and to go without food for long periods of time.

Q: What do reptiles and amphibians eat?
A: Reptiles and amphibians have varied diets that depend on their species and size. Generally, reptiles tend to eat mostly insects, small rodents, and other small animals while larger reptiles may even eat fish or bird eggs. Amphibians usually feed on smaller animals like insects, worms, and small fish, and those that live in water may also eat larvae and tadpoles.
Q: How do reptiles and amphibians protect themselves from predators?
A: Reptiles and amphibians have a variety of ways to protect themselves from predators. Reptiles typically rely on their armor-like scales and sharp claws to ward off predators, while amphibians usually rely on their coloration and patterns to blend in with their environment and remain undetected by predators. Both types of animals have adapted their bodies to move quickly and to be able to hide in small crevices to avoid being detected by potential predators.
